Bradley County (TN) 911 Implements APCO EMD
Bradley County (TN) 911 recently implemented the APCO Institute Emergency Medical Dispatch (EMD) Program. Bradley County 911 is a consolidated dispatch center serving Cleveland City, Bradley County and the City of Charleston with an annual call volume of 17,000.
APCO RELEASES MISSING CHILD RESPONSE GUIDECARDS
October 23, 2008, Washington, DC - The Association of Public-Safety Communications Officials (APCO) International released today guidecards to aid calltakers in handling calls pertaining to missing and exploited children through its APCO Institute. The Missing Children Guidecards are based on the APCO International American National Standard, released last year, and serve as a reference specifically for emergency calltakers to present the missing and/or sexually exploited child response process in a logical progression from the initial call through the first response.

The APCO Institute Leadership Certificate Program is a comprehensive 12 month online program leading to the professional designation of Registered Public-Safety Leader (RPL).

APCO “Virtual College” is an Internet-based distance learning academic program designed for, and directed specifically toward individuals in the public safety communications and 9-1-1 profession.
